Raptors Report Week 2: Raps Can’t Wait to Be Home

November 7th, 2010 by Sachin Arora Leave a reply »
The Raptors had a pretty ugly week. When you go winless, it's always going to be a bad week, but there were actually some sparks to give the fans of Toronto confidence going forward.

The Raps never do well on the road, and never seem to do well against the West, so when it's the West on the road, it can't be a good combination.

The first game of the road trip was against the Sacramento Kings, a game in which the Raptors led by as much as 17 points, but the Raptors let Tyreke Evans take over and that one slipped away.

The second game was against the Utah Jazz, and the Jazz took over early and grabbed a huge lead. The Raptors cut the lead to one point, but the Jazz were too much to handle.

The third game of the week was against the Lakers, and was probably the Raptors best game of the season despite losing. The Lakers are arguably the best team in the league, and the Raptors stayed in the game the whole night on their home court, but just couldn't control the Gasol-Kobe tandem down the stretch and lost by a respectable margin of 5 points.

The last game of the road swing was an embarrassing blowout to Portland.
